What is order appointing probate conservator
The Order Appointing Probate Conservator is a legal document used by the court in California to officially appoint a successor conservator for a person or estate when the conservatee cannot manage their resources.

Understanding the Order Appointing Probate Conservator
The Order Appointing Probate Conservator is a legal document essential in California, used for establishing a conservatorship. Its primary role is to appoint a conservator who can effectively manage the personal and financial affairs of a conservatee—someone unable to handle their own matters.
This form is utilized when the conservatee exhibits an inability to manage their affairs, signaling the need for a responsible party to take over. Understanding its significance is crucial for ensuring the proper administration of the conservatorship process.

Who is eligible to use the Order Appointing Probate Conservator?
Any individual or entity seeking to appoint a conservator for someone unable to manage their personal or financial affairs can use this form, typically involving parties like family members or attorneys.
Are there any deadlines for submitting this form?
While there are no strict deadlines for the submission of the Order Appointing Probate Conservator, it is advisable to submit it as soon as possible to ensure timely processing in conservatorship cases.
How do I submit the completed form?
You can submit the completed Order Appointing Probate Conservator form by filing it directly with the appropriate court in California. Some may allow electronic submissions, while others may require physical filing.
What supporting documents are required with this form?
Alongside the Order Appointing Probate Conservator, you may be required to provide documents proving the conservatee's inability to manage their affairs, such as medical records or affidavits from professionals.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the form?
Common mistakes include leaving fields blank, failing to use the correct legal language, and not providing required attachments. Ensure all sections are filled out completely and accurately.
How long does it take to process this form?
Processing times for the Order Appointing Probate Conservator can vary by court. Typically, it can take a few days to several weeks, depending on the court’s workload and policies.
Can this form be used for temporary conservatorship?
No, the Order Appointing Probate Conservator is not intended for temporary conservatorships. You should seek a different form specifically designed for that purpose.
